Choosing the Right Baby Food Maker: A Buying Guide
Core Features to Consider
When selecting a baby food maker, several features contribute to ease of use, safety, and the quality of the food you prepare. Focusing on these will help you find the best model for your needs.
1. Steaming & Blending Capabilities: The core function of any baby food maker is to steam and blend. Consider whether you prefer an all-in-one unit that does both sequentially, or if you’re comfortable steaming ingredients separately. All-in-one models (like the Bear NutriEase) are convenient, minimizing transfer and potential mess. However, separate steaming allows for greater control over cooking times and textures, and can be beneficial for batch cooking. The quality of the steaming process is also important; look for systems that use gentle steam circulation to preserve nutrients.
2. Capacity & Batch Cooking: Think about how much food you want to prepare at once. Smaller capacity models (under 3 cups) are ideal for single servings, while larger capacity options (like the Bear Dual-Layer Steam Basket) are better for batch cooking and freezing. Batch cooking saves time and ensures you always have healthy options on hand. Dual-layer baskets are particularly useful for separating flavors or cooking different ingredients simultaneously.
3. Consistency Control: Babies’ dietary needs change rapidly as they grow. A good baby food maker allows you to adjust the texture of the food to suit your baby’s developmental stage. Look for models with multiple speed settings or blending modes (manual and auto) – this is a feature found in several models, like the Bear NutriEase and Chefhandy 5-in-1. Manual control gives you precise customization, while automatic settings offer convenience.
Other Important Features
- Safety Features: Prioritize models with safety locks, automatic shut-off functions, and BPA-free materials.
- Ease of Cleaning: Dishwasher-safe parts and self-cleaning functions (like those found in the Bear NutriEase and Bc Babycare) save valuable time and effort.
- Material: Glass bowls are often preferred for their non-porous nature and resistance to staining, while stainless steel blades offer durability.
- Additional Functions: Some models offer additional features like milk warming or bottle sterilization (Babymoov Duo Meal Station). Consider if these features align with your needs.
- Control Type: Touch screen controls (EVLA’S Touch Screen Baby Food Maker) offer a modern and intuitive user experience.
